In April, Rosslare generally has low temperatures and moderate rainfall. Anticipate daytime temperatures around 11°C, while night temperatures can drop to 8°C.
Rosslare in April usually receives moderate rainfall, averaging around 68 mm for the month. When we look at the climate data from the last 30 years, we can expect around 14 days of rain.
The city usually sees around 175 hours of sunlight, indicating a moderately sunny period.
If you prefer dry days with pleasant temperatures, August typically offers the best circumstances. While January, February, March, November and December tend to showcase less optimal conditions.

So, what should you wear in Rosslare in April?
Plan on layering your clothes. Some days or part of the day it will be nice and warm and some moments it can be a bit chilly. Bring a rain jacket in case it rains during your stay. With a water temperature of around 9°C there is no need to bring your swimwear.What To Do
